Abstract: A wireless transmit/receive unit (WTRU) may establish a connection with a non-3GPP device. For example, the non-3GPP device may be a smart watch a tablet, a health monitoring device, or an appliance. The connection may be established via a wireless communication protocol, such as WiFi or Bluetooth. The WTRU may establish a connection with a cellular network. The non-3GPP device may lack the capability to connect directly to the cellular network. The WTRU may receive a request from the non-3GPP device for access to the cellular network. The WTRU may perform an authentication procedure with the network using information from the request, such as an identity of the non-3GPP device. After authentication, the WTRU may route data traffic between the non-3GPP device and the cellular network.

Abstract: Methods and systems are disclosed for determining context information for one or more peers to be used in a peer discovery and/or peer association process(es) and/or to otherwise facilitate P2P proximity communications. For example, a method for determining peer context information may include receiving a context-aware identifier (CAID). The CAID may include one or more items of context information associated with the peer in addition to an indication of an identity of the peer. A first portion of the CAID may be decoded to determine a first item of context information associated with the peer. The first portion of the CAID may be decodable without having to process a payload portion of the message. It may be determined whether to continue processing one or more of the CAID or the message based on the first item of context information. The CAID may be used in discovery and/or association procedure(s).

Abstract: Cellular devices are becoming more and more powerful, and may host a number of different non-cellular capabilities, such as cameras, accelerometers, and sensors. Today, these capabilities are used mainly to provide some service to the device or the device owner. Disclosed herein are methods and systems for enabling devices to register their device capabilities with a cellular network, providing a mechanism for Application Servers to discover non-cellular capabilities of the devices, providing a mechanism to have the Application Servers configure these non-cellular capabilities of the devices, and preparing the device and the network for cellular traffic generated as a result of the Application Server using these non-cellular capabilities.
